**Form EIA-819 Moderator’s Guide**


This guide is designed to provide the moderator and the client the various topics and issues to be covered. A good focus group should be conversational. Keep in mind that the questions may not be asked verbatim nor will they necessarily be asked in the same order.


[I. Introduction and EIA’s purpose of conducting this survey (1 minute)]


Welcome and thank you for participating in this focus group.


EIA uses Form EIA-819 and EIA-22M to collect information from companies that produce fuel ethanol, biodiesel, renewable fuels, and fuel oxygenates. EIA is considering merging these two forms into a single survey form.


We will review each portion of this survey and we will ask for your feedback on each screen. Some screenshots may not apply to your facility, however, please provide feedback on each screenshot, even if your facility does not produce or use a particular product.


Please note there are no right or wrong answers. We want your honest thoughts and opinions. You don’t need to worry about typos or spelling and everyone can type at once.


[II. Warm-up Topics (5 minutes)]


Please tell me a little about your background experience or education in ethanol or biodiesel fuel production operations?


Are you the person responsible to fill out the survey forms EIA-22 or EIA-819 for your company? If no, who is?


How long have you been filling out these survey forms?


What is your job title/position?


Based on operations at your facility, how would you classify your organization?


  • Group 1 (Producers of fuel ethanol) Current EIA-819 Respondents


  • Group 2 (Producers of biodiesel) Current EIA-22 M Respondents


  • Group 3 (Producers of renewable diesel fuel, heating oil, jet fuel, naphtha, gasoline, and other renewable fuels not listed elsewhere) Possible EIA-810 Respondents


  • Group 4 (Producers of Motor Gasoline Blending Components and oxygenates for fuel use) EIA-819 respondents
